Turbo taking too long to spool,too much turbo lag.Turbo is original TD04 from EVOIII engine 4G63T.This is quite small,I cannot understand why it is taking so long to initiate.I have deduced it is one of three things,either the turbo is damaged(I don't know how),my exhaust is leaking between the head and the turbo(I should hear something if this is the case) or last but not least,boost escaping somewhere between the intercooler and the intake on the head.What should I do,change turbo but b4 how to know what is wrong.

get a boost and vacumm meter to check for any leakings of pressure.

remove the extrator and turbo manifold to check for any sorts of cracks.

If you turbo is damaged, you're fcuked and you can see smoke coming from your turbo, so it is definitely not a damaged turbo.

otherwise, the next possible reason could be a stuffed up wastegate actuator. by the way, when you mean laggy, at what rpm does your turbo hit full boost?

Does this happens all the time? because when it is like really hot outside, every turbo cars are laggy, trust me :)

do a leak test
from ur intercooler piping there will be a small vacuum hose heading to actuator
plug tht hose out
use ur mechanics compressor gun to shoot air into the pipings, hear for leaks

Vehicle is 1995 edition EVOIII came originally from Mitsubishi motors so I hardly think the company made a mistake.But anyhow I checked the turbo,all seals are in order it is in good condition.I did pressure test on the boost lines and concluded that there exists a piece of hose between the turbo and the intercooler that swells up when boost kicks in.It swells up untill approximately 13psi and then starts to leak.This is why sometimes the car laggs when you pull off,but if you quickly release the accelarator and then flaw it back,you get full boost and the car responds very well.I am changing all hoses to pipes using high density hose as joiners only.Secondly the actuator on the wastegate is faulty,it does not always respond and when it does it moves very slow.Sometimes it opens and takes very long to close and sometimes it doesn't open and sometimes it remains open.What to do about that.I am thinking it wants cleaning,I am thinking of cleaning carbon built up areas with gasoline and corrosion cleaner or carbeaurator spray.Am I on track or do I need to change anything?
